Thomas Strøm is a Clinical Professor and Head of Research at the University of Southern Denmark, specializing in Intensive Care Medicine. He is internationally renowned for his pioneering research in critical care, particularly focusing on non-sedation protocols for mechanically ventilated patients, early mobility, and delirium management. His groundbreaking studies have been published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et and The New England Journal of Medicine, significantly influencing intensive care practices worldwide. Thomas is frequently invited as a keynote speaker at leading international conferences and is recognized for his engaging presentations that challenge conventional approaches and advocate for patient-centered, evidence-based care.
